a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Johannes Berg <johannes.berg@intel.com>2017-10-11 09:46:45 -0400
committerJohannes Berg <johannes.berg@intel.com>2017-10-11 09:46:45 -0400
commit9e97964d5e500d8d0df94e1a79ad715ad4f9c995 (patch)
treeafc487aa0301fb1594187b433d7daf67add76ace
parent90a53e4432b12288316efaa5f308adafb8d304b0 (diff)
mac80211: use crypto_aead_authsize()
Evidently this API is intended to be used to isolate against API changes, so use it instead of accessing ->authsize. Signed-off-by: Johannes Berg <johannes.berg@intel.com>
-rw-r--r--net/mac80211/aead_api.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/net/mac80211/aead_api.c b/net/mac80211/aead_api.c
index 347f13953b2c..160f9df30402 100644
--- a/net/mac80211/aead_api.c
+++ b/net/mac80211/aead_api.c
@@ -21,7 +21,7 @@
21int aead_encrypt(struct crypto_aead *tfm, u8 *b_0, u8 *aad, size_t aad_len, 21int aead_encrypt(struct crypto_aead *tfm, u8 *b_0, u8 *aad, size_t aad_len,
22 u8 *data, size_t data_len, u8 *mic) 22 u8 *data, size_t data_len, u8 *mic)
23{ 23{
24 size_t mic_len = tfm->authsize; 24 size_t mic_len = crypto_aead_authsize(tfm);
25 struct scatterlist sg[3]; 25 struct scatterlist sg[3];
26 struct aead_request *aead_req; 26 struct aead_request *aead_req;
27 int reqsize = sizeof(*aead_req) + crypto_aead_reqsize(tfm); 27 int reqsize = sizeof(*aead_req) + crypto_aead_reqsize(tfm);
@@ -52,7 +52,7 @@ int aead_encrypt(struct crypto_aead *tfm, u8 *b_0, u8 *aad, size_t aad_len,
52int aead_decrypt(struct crypto_aead *tfm, u8 *b_0, u8 *aad, size_t aad_len, 52int aead_decrypt(struct crypto_aead *tfm, u8 *b_0, u8 *aad, size_t aad_len,
53 u8 *data, size_t data_len, u8 *mic) 53 u8 *data, size_t data_len, u8 *mic)
54{ 54{
55 size_t mic_len = tfm->authsize; 55 size_t mic_len = crypto_aead_authsize(tfm);
56 struct scatterlist sg[3]; 56 struct scatterlist sg[3];
57 struct aead_request *aead_req; 57 struct aead_request *aead_req;
58 int reqsize = sizeof(*aead_req) + crypto_aead_reqsize(tfm); 58 int reqsize = sizeof(*aead_req) + crypto_aead_reqsize(tfm);